Ticket: Vault locked — dark-mode tokens unavailable. Plugin authors: the Gridboard admin dashboard theming vault auto-locked after the token rotation failed Tuesday. Until it's open, the dark-mode palette variables won't resolve and your plugins will render with fallback light styles. Don't hardcode hex values as a workaround; it breaks the contrast audit. Fix ETA unknown. If you have maintainer access and need the tokens now, unlock the vault yourself with the recovery passphrase below.

unlock words, kajef-kadug: sorys-pelax-lamael-tamvan-briiel-novdor-fenwyn-tamdor-oliion-keleth-julok-belion-ralok

Quarterly Planning Note — Divestiture of the Coastal Tooling Unit

For the finance team: the sale of the Coastal Tooling unit to Pellmark Industries remains on track for close in Q3. Please finalize the carve-out balance sheet, reconcile intercompany positions, and prepare the working-capital adjustment schedule by month-end. Audit support requests should be prioritized. For planning purposes, note the following sensitive item:

internal memo for hawef-kahif: The finance team signed off on a budget of $25.9 million for Project Sorox. The renewal with Pelokek Logistics closes at $51.7 million a year, 52 percent below the last contract.

## Formula sandbox tuning

User-supplied formulas in Gridmoor execute inside a restricted interpreter with hard ceilings on time, memory, and call depth. Reviewers should confirm any change to these ceilings is justified in the PR description, since raising them widens the abuse surface. Defaults were chosen from production traces. The current limits are as follows.

limits module of tafog-fawip:
WEIGHTS = {
    "julix": 57,
    "lamys": 992,
    "kasvan": 209,
    "quenok": 750,
    "alddor": 259,
    "oliath": 1009,
    "wenix": 815,
}

## Ticket: Log sampling misconfigured on chirper-svc

Hey on-call — chirper-svc is blasting full debug logs again and the ingest bill is climbing. Looks like the sampling rate got wiped during last night's redeploy. Set `LOG_SAMPLE_RATE=0.05` and restart the pods. While you're in there, the log shipper also lost its auth credential, so the env file needs this line re-added right below the sampling config:

vault entry, yahif-yajep: COURIER_KEY29=b802bdf8034096b65a51c6ba5abe2